the-queen-is-captured-the-chess-game-is-over.jpg?width=746&format=pjpg&exif=0&iptc=01. Accessibility and Ease:
One of many major reasons behind the widespread selling point of on-line poker is its accessibility. In comparison to brick-and-mortar gambling enterprises, online poker platforms provide players the freedom to play anytime, everywhere. With a stable net connection, poker lovers will enjoy their favorite online game from the absolute comfort of their particular domiciles, eliminating the need for travel. Furthermore, online poker websites supply an array of options, including different variations of poker, tournaments, and different stake levels, catering to players of ability levels.

2. Global Athlete Base:
On-line poker transcends geographic boundaries, enabling players from all sides of the world to compete against each other. This interconnectedness fosters a diverse and challenging environment, permitting players to evaluate their particular skills against opponents with different strategies and playing designs. In addition, internet poker platforms usually function radiant communities where people can talk about strategies, share experiences, and take part in friendly competitors.

3. Lower Expenses and Smaller Stakes:
When compared with traditional gambling enterprises, playing poker online can notably reduce costs. Online systems have reduced expense costs, allowing them to provide reduced stakes and decreased entry fees for tournaments. This makes online poker accessible to a wider market, including beginners and informal people, just who may find the large Stakes casino of live casinos intimidating. The capability to play with smaller stakes additionally provides a feeling of monetary safety, permitting people to handle their particular money more effectively.

4. Enhanced Game Access and Selection:
Internet poker systems offer an enormous assortment of online game choices and variations. Whether it is texas holdem, Omaha, or Seven-Card Stud, players find their preferred game effortlessly and instantly. More over, online platforms regularly introduce brand new poker variations, spicing within the game play and keeping the knowledge fresh for people. The availability of a multitude of tables and tournaments ensures that people always look for ideal options and never have to await a seat at a table.

5. Challenges and Drawbacks:
While online poker brings many advantages, it isn't without its difficulties. The significant drawbacks may be the possibility deceptive activities, including collusion and processor chip dumping, in which players cheat to gain an unfair advantage. But reputable internet poker systems employ sturdy safety steps and arbitrary number generators to thwart these types of behavior. Furthermore, some people could find the lack of physical cues and communications that are section of real time poker games a disadvantage, as they can be harder to read opponents and employ emotional tactics on the web.
